1.
the magnitude of something in a particular direction (especially length or width or height)
2.
(physics) the physical units of a quantity, expressed in terms of fundamental quantities like time, mass and length
velocity has dimensions of length/time
3.
a construct whereby objects or individuals can be distinguished
4.
one of three Cartesian coordinates that determine a position in space
5.
magnitude or extent
'dimension' - used as a verb
6.
indicate the dimensions on
These techniques permit us to dimension the human heart
7.
shape or form to required dimensions
